Transaction 19e661a73e2956eceb4d1382f63daf07b2a8f385cad742e661c22fc843c0f82a
1 Input
2 Outputs
- 19e661a73e2956eceb4d1382f63daf07b2a8f385cad742e661c22fc843c0f82a:0
- 19e661a73e2956eceb4d1382f63daf07b2a8f385cad742e661c22fc843c0f82a:1
value 154261340631
address 148S8wfsSP9KWEZk7LoR6YioEMzfnZ6o2U
value 999990000
address 1Lj4Nv61ADXzdcLAj2bUc5HWpKUZ9N7rvK